logo

Postman高效调用DeepSeek API接口全指南

作者:Nicky2025.09.25 16:06浏览量:2

简介:本文详细介绍如何使用Postman调用DeepSeek API接口,涵盖环境配置、请求构造、参数设置、错误处理等关键环节,帮助开发者快速实现与DeepSeek服务的无缝对接。

Postman调用DeepSeek API接口全指南

一、引言:为什么选择Postman调用DeepSeek API

在当今AI技术飞速发展的背景下,DeepSeek作为一款领先的深度学习平台,提供了丰富的API接口供开发者调用。无论是进行自然语言处理图像识别还是其他AI任务,DeepSeek API都能提供强大的支持。而Postman作为一款流行的API开发工具,以其直观的界面、强大的调试功能和丰富的插件生态,成为开发者调用API的首选工具。

本文将详细介绍如何使用Postman调用DeepSeek API接口,帮助开发者快速上手,提高开发效率。通过本文的指导,开发者将能够轻松构造API请求,处理响应数据,并解决常见的调用问题。

二、准备工作:环境配置与账号注册

1. 安装Postman

首先,开发者需要在本地计算机上安装Postman。Postman支持Windows、macOS和Linux等多种操作系统,开发者可以根据自己的需求选择合适的版本进行安装。安装完成后,打开Postman,创建一个新的工作空间或使用现有的工作空间。

2. 注册DeepSeek账号

在使用DeepSeek API之前,开发者需要注册一个DeepSeek账号。访问DeepSeek官方网站,按照提示完成注册流程。注册成功后,开发者将获得一个API密钥,这是调用DeepSeek API的重要凭证。请务必妥善保管API密钥,避免泄露。

3. 获取API文档

在调用DeepSeek API之前,开发者需要仔细阅读API文档。API文档详细描述了各个接口的功能、请求参数、响应格式以及错误码等信息。通过阅读API文档,开发者可以更好地理解API的使用方法,避免因参数设置错误而导致的调用失败。

三、构造API请求:关键步骤与参数设置

1. 创建新的请求

在Postman中,点击“New”按钮,选择“Request”创建一个新的请求。在请求编辑界面,开发者可以设置请求的URL、方法(GET、POST等)、请求头、请求体等参数。

2. 设置请求URL

根据API文档中的说明,设置请求的URL。URL通常包括基础URL和端点路径两部分。例如,如果DeepSeek API的基础URL为https://api.deepseek.com,端点路径为/v1/text/generate,则完整的请求URL为https://api.deepseek.com/v1/text/generate

3. 设置请求方法

根据API文档中的说明,选择合适的请求方法。常见的请求方法包括GET、POST、PUT、DELETE等。对于DeepSeek API,大多数接口都使用POST方法进行请求。

4. 设置请求头

在请求头中,开发者需要设置Content-Typeapplication/json,表示请求体为JSON格式。此外,还需要设置Authorization头,将API密钥作为Bearer Token进行传递。例如:

  1. Authorization: Bearer your_api_key_here

5. 设置请求体

根据API文档中的说明,构造请求体。请求体通常为JSON格式,包含调用API所需的参数。例如,如果调用文本生成接口,请求体可能如下:

  1. {
  2. "prompt": "请生成一段关于人工智能的介绍",
  3. "max_tokens": 100
  4. }

在Postman中,选择“Body”选项卡,选择“raw”格式,并从下拉菜单中选择“JSON”。然后,在文本框中输入上述JSON数据。

四、发送请求与处理响应

1. 发送请求

完成请求构造后,点击“Send”按钮发送请求。Postman将向DeepSeek API服务器发送请求,并等待响应。

2. 处理响应

响应数据通常以JSON格式返回。在Postman中,开发者可以在“Responses”选项卡中查看响应数据。响应数据可能包含生成的结果、状态码以及错误信息等。

3. 解析响应数据

根据API文档中的说明,解析响应数据。例如,如果调用文本生成接口,响应数据可能如下:

  1. {
  2. "text": "人工智能是一种模拟人类智能的技术...",
  3. "status": "success"
  4. }

开发者可以使用JavaScript或其他编程语言对响应数据进行进一步处理,以满足业务需求。

五、常见问题与解决方案

1. 认证失败

如果收到认证失败的错误响应,请检查Authorization头是否正确设置,以及API密钥是否有效。确保API密钥没有过期或被撤销。

2. 参数错误

如果收到参数错误的错误响应,请检查请求体中的参数是否符合API文档中的要求。确保所有必填参数都已设置,并且参数类型正确。

3. 请求超时

如果请求超时,请检查网络连接是否稳定。此外,可以尝试增加Postman的超时设置,或联系DeepSeek技术支持以获取帮助。

4. 速率限制

DeepSeek API可能对调用频率进行限制。如果收到速率限制的错误响应,请减少调用频率,或联系DeepSeek技术支持以获取更高的调用限额。

六、高级功能与最佳实践

1. 使用环境变量

在Postman中,可以使用环境变量来存储API密钥、基础URL等常用参数。这样,在不同环境(如开发、测试、生产)之间切换时,只需修改环境变量的值即可,无需修改每个请求的参数。

2. 编写测试脚本

Postman支持编写测试脚本,对响应数据进行自动化测试。例如,可以编写脚本检查响应数据中的状态码是否为200,或检查生成的结果是否符合预期。

3. 使用集合与文件夹

将相关的API请求组织到同一个集合或文件夹中,便于管理和共享。例如,可以将所有与文本生成相关的请求组织到一个名为“Text Generation”的集合中。

4. 文档与注释

在Postman中,可以为每个请求添加文档和注释,说明请求的功能、参数以及预期结果等。这样,其他开发者可以更容易地理解和使用这些请求。

七、结论与展望

通过本文的介绍,开发者已经掌握了如何使用Postman调用DeepSeek API接口的关键步骤和技巧。从环境配置、请求构造到响应处理,每个环节都至关重要。通过不断实践和探索,开发者将能够更高效地利用DeepSeek API进行开发,推动AI技术在各个领域的应用和发展。

未来,随着AI技术的不断进步和DeepSeek平台的不断完善,调用DeepSeek API将变得更加简单和高效。我们期待看到更多创新的AI应用涌现出来,为人类社会带来更多的便利和价值。

相关文章推荐

发表评论

活动